Vi. Lukhovitskii et Vv. Polikarpov, ON THE EFFECT OF PHASE RATIO ON THE EFFICIENCY OF RADIATION GRAFTING IN LATEX SYSTEMS, High energy chemistry, 31(2), 1997, pp. 85-88
The effect of aqueous phase on the efficiency of radiation-induced gra
ft copolymerization of styrene and acrylonitrile onto butyl acrylate-a
crylonitrile copolymer and butyl rubber in latexes was studied. The mo
lecular mass of the butyl acrylate-acrylonitrile copolymer decreases a
nd the grafting efficiency increases with increase in the ratio of the
aqueous phase, thus suggesting that grafting sites emerge primarily d
ue to indirect action of gamma-radiation. This indirect action cannot
be explained in terms of interaction of primary products of water radi
olysis with polymer molecules in latex particles.
